Sign in to save movies/tv to your own lists, favorites, or watchlist.
not specified
Known for Crew
as
Uncle Carlos
2005
Special Effects Coordinator
2017
Special Effects
2010
Makeup Artist
2009
2007
Production Design
Special Effects Makeup Artist
1990
1987